University of Edinburgh OER Vision
Three strands building on:
• The history of the Edinburgh Settlement.
• Excellent education and research collections.
• Traditions of the Enlightenment and civic mission.
University of Edinburgh OER Vision
For the common good
• OER exchange to enrich University and the sector.
• Support frameworks to enable staff to share OER created as a routine part of their work.
• Enable staff to find and use high quality teaching materials developed within and beyond the University.
University of Edinburgh OER Vision
Edinburgh at its best
• Showcasing the highest quality learning and teaching.
• Identify collections of high quality learning materials to be published online for flexible use, and made available as open courseware.
• Enable the discovery of these materials to enhance the University’s reputation.
University of Edinburgh OER VisionEdinburgh’s treasures
• Make available collections of unique resources to promote health, economic and cultural well-being.
• Digitise, curate and share major collections of archives, treasures, museum resources to encourage public engagement with learning, study and research.
• Develop policy and infrastructure to ensure OER collections are sustainable.
University of Edinburgh OER Policy
• Approved by Learning and Teaching Committee.
• Encourages staff and students to use, create and publish OERs to enhance the quality of the student experience.
• Help colleagues make informed decisions about creating and using OER in support of the University’s OER Vision.
University of Edinburgh OER Policy
• Adapted from University of Leeds OER Policy.
• Defines OER as:
“Digital resources that are used in the context of teaching and learning, which have been released by the copyright holder under an open licence permitting their use or re-purposing by others.”

Wikimedian in Residence
• One year residency Jan 2016 – Jan 2017.
• Aims to facilitate a sustainable relationship between university & Wikimedia UK to benefit of both communities.
• Training and workshops to further quantity and quality of open knowledge and the University’s commitment to digital literacy.
